Our People Versus Yours are a five-piece Post-Hardcore band from various parts of Essex. Formed in September 2007, but eventually getting a solid line up march 2008, they recorded their first ever single entitled “Here Comes the Flood” at Escape Route Productions (Silent Descent and more), which quickly established the band. After playing numerous gigs throughout the country they headed back to Escape Route to finish their debut EP also called “Here Comes the Flood.”
